ESPN Analyst Predicts Marlins and Alcantara to Shine in 2026
Marlins off to hot start, analyst sees division title and Cy Young in their future

Lofty predictions for the Marlins and their ace pitcher Alcantara raise expectations for a potential playoff push.Today in MiamiThe Miami Marlins have started the 2026 MLB season with a 6-5 record, including a sweep of the Athletics and series win over the Rockies. An ESPN analyst is making bold predictions about the Marlins' and star pitcher Sandy Alcantara's success this year.
Why it matters
The Marlins have struggled in recent seasons but appear to have turned a corner with their hot start. If the analyst's predictions come true, it would mark a major turnaround for the franchise and cement Alcantara as one of the game's elite pitchers.
The details
The Marlins opened the season 5-1 before cooling off a bit to 6-5. An ESPN analyst is now predicting the team will win the NL East division title and that Marlins ace Sandy Alcantara will take home the NL Cy Young award.
